The Cincinnati Reds will face their divisional rival Pittsburgh Pirates at PNC Park. The first pitch is scheduled for 7:05 p.m. ET and the matchup will be shown on either ATPT or FSOH.

Cincinnati Reds vs. Pittsburgh Pirates Odds

Pittsburgh (-205) is favored over Cincinnati (+187) and oddsmakers have put the Over/Under for this night game at 8.5 runs (-105 for the over and -115 for the under). Gamblers can also bet on the game’s runline with the most recent odds standing at -115 for the Reds +1.5 runs and -105 for the Pirates -1.5 runs.

The Reds are 59-80 SU and are 78-60 against the spread (ATS). They’ve lost 7.6 units for moneyline gamblers, despite having gained 4.0 units ATS. Cincinnati’s covered the spread five times in its last seven games and the total has gone over in four of those seven. The Pirates, on the other hand, are 68-71 SU and 66-72 ATS. They’ve lost 4.0 units for bettors taking the moneyline and 13.3 units ATS. Pittsburgh has a 3-4 ATS mark over its last seven outings and the under has hit in six of those seven.

Pittsburgh games have a 61-68-9 over/under record in 2018. The Reds have been a decent over bet with a total record of 71-63-4.

The right-handed Homer Bailey is getting the nod for the visiting Reds. Bailey (1-13, 6.13 ERA) has racked up 71 strikeouts in 101.1 innings so far. He’s 0-1 with five strikeouts and a 7.45 ERA against Pittsburgh this year (two starts).

The Pirates will be sending righty Jameson Taillon (11-9, 3.45 ERA) to the hill. Taillon has 146 punchouts and 40 walks to his credit, as well as a 1.20 WHIP. Taillon is 2-1 with 21 strikeouts and a 3.10 ERA over three starts against Cincinnati this year.

As a unit, Pittsburgh’s pitchers have allowed 4.3 runs per game overall in 2018. Its starters have an ERA of 4.05, a WHIP of 1.27 and a strikeouts-per-nine of 7.3. The bullpen has a 4.01 ERA, 1.38 WHIP and 9.6 K/9. In 59 divisional games, Pirates starters have an ERA of 3.42 and the bullpen’s ERA is 3.26.

The Pittsburgh hitters have put up 4.3 runs per contest, including 4.5 per game against divisional foes and 3.8 per game over their last five. The team has hit .235/.262/.346 over its last five games and is 3-2 SU during that span.

The Pirates’ batters have been led by outfielders Starling Marte and Corey Dickerson. Marte is hitting .278/.323/.458 with 18 home runs, 63 RBIs, 70 runs and 30 stolen bases, while Dickerson’s line is .291/.320/.453 with 11 homers, 46 RBIs and 54 runs scored.

In the other dugout, Cincinnati’s pitchers have allowed 5.2 runs per game and its starters own a 5.20 ERA, 1.45 WHIP and 7.58 K/9. The bullpen has logged an ERA of 4.22, along with a K-per-9 of 8.00.

Reds hitters have slashed .258/.335/.406 on their way to 4.5 runs scored per game this year, including 4.1 runs per game against divisional foes and 3.8 per game over the team’s last five contests (2-3 SU).

Second baseman Scooter Gennett and shortstop Jose Peraza continue to lead Cincinnati’s offense. Gennett is hitting .322/.369/.515 with 22 home runs, 84 RBIs and 82 runs scored. Peraza is slashing .283/.323/.397 with nine homers, 45 RBIs, 73 runs and 20 steals.

The Reds have lost 11.6 units and are 55-46 ATS when facing a righty starter this season. The over has cashed in 50 of those games, compared to 48 that’ve gone under in such games. On the other hand, the Pirates have netted 3.8 units and are 49-50 ATS when facing a righty starter. The over’s cashed in 38 of those games, compared to 53 that’ve gone under.
